The Los Angeles Emissary (LAE), a project of Community Initiatives, advances housing justice for youth and young adults in Los Angeles County by centering the voices and leadership of those with lived experience of homelessness and system involvement as co-decision makers within the homeless response system; training a network of young people across L.A. County with skills needed to become advocates around funding and policy priorities related to homelessness; and engaging in collaborative decision making to address youth homelessness with young people, funders, providers, county, and system partners. Through a ground-breaking homeless system redesign, we aim to create a youth centered approach that effectively meets the needs and aspirations of unhoused young people.
